Why Does Purpose Matter?
Having a sense of purpose isn't just a philosophical musing; it's a vital force that shapes our well-being. Studies have shown that individuals with a strong sense of purpose experience:
- Enhanced Happiness and Life Satisfaction: Knowing what fuels your passion provides direction and meaning, leading to greater enjoyment and contentment.
- Improved Resilience: When faced with challenges, a sense of purpose acts as a guiding light, helping you navigate through difficult times with a sense of perspective and strength.
- Boosted Motivation and Productivity: Knowing your "why" ignites your inner drive, propelling you forward with focus and commitment.
- Stronger Relationships: When your purpose aligns with your values, it fosters authenticity and attracts individuals who share your vision.

Unveiling Your Inner Compass
So, how do we uncover this innate sense of purpose? The journey is as individual as the starlight, but here are a few paths to illuminate your way:
- Connect with your values: What principles guide your decisions and actions? What makes you feel truly alive? Reflecting on your core values provides a foundation for building your purpose.
- Explore your passions: What activities ignite your spark? What are you naturally drawn to? Immersing yourself in your passions reveals hidden strengths and interests that can shape your purpose.
- Consider your strengths and gifts: What are you naturally good at? What unique skills or talents do you possess? Recognizing your strengths empowers you to contribute meaningfully to the world.
- Seek inspiration: Learn from the stories of others who have found their purpose. Read biographies, connect with mentors, and explore diverse perspectives. Their journeys can offer valuable insights and encouragement.
- Take action: Don't wait for a lightning bolt moment. Start small, experiment, and take action steps towards activities that resonate with your values and passions. The path to purpose is paved with consistent effort.
Remember, your sense of purpose is not static. It can evolve and adapt as you grow and learn. Embrace the journey of discovery, and trust that your inner compass will guide you towards a life filled with meaning and fulfillment.
